陕西一季度工业良好开局夯实基本盘
Shan Xi Ri Bao· 2025-04-27 22:52
Group 1 - In the first quarter of this year, Shaanxi's industrial added value growth rate reached 9.9%, surpassing the GDP growth rate by 4.3 percentage points, marking the highest growth since August 2021 and ranking fourth nationwide [1] - The energy industry maintained stability with an 8.8% year-on-year increase in added value, accelerating by 0.8 percentage points compared to the previous year [2] - Non-energy industries showed remarkable performance with a growth rate of 11.8%, contributing over 4.2 percentage points to the overall industrial added value growth [2] Group 2 - The automotive industry, a key pillar for Shaanxi, saw a significant increase in added value by 32.9% year-on-year, becoming a core driving force for industrial growth [3] - Major industrial products experienced production increases, including a 76.5% rise in power batteries and a 23.4% increase in charging piles [3] - BYD, a leading enterprise, achieved a record high in quarterly output value, significantly contributing to the stability of industrial growth in Shaanxi [4] Group 3 - Strategic emerging industries in Shaanxi grew by 6.2% year-on-year, with their GDP share increasing to 11.8%, up by 1.2 percentage points [5] - The province is advancing towards high-end, intelligent, and green development, integrating traditional industries with digital technology [5] - Shaanxi's semiconductor industry ranks among the top in the country, with flagship projects in new energy vehicles and high-end LCD panels emerging as new symbols of "Shaanxi Intelligent Manufacturing" [5]

2月涨幅超90%,营利双丰收,业绩报后涂鸦智能股价缘何遭负反馈?
美股研究社· 2025-02-27 10:41
Core Viewpoint - The article highlights the successful transformation of Tuya Smart, which has achieved significant revenue growth and profitability in 2024, driven by its focus on AI and IoT integration, despite previous losses [3][6][12]. Financial Performance - Tuya Smart reported preliminary unaudited revenue of $299 million for the fiscal year ending December 31, 2024, representing a year-over-year increase of 29.8% [3][8]. - The company turned a profit with a net income of $4.997 million, compared to a net loss of $60.315 million in the previous year [3][6]. - The operating loss for 2024 was $47.6 million, a significant reduction from the $106 million loss in 2023, indicating improved operational efficiency [6][11]. Quarterly Growth - In Q1 2024, Tuya Smart achieved total revenue of $61.7 million, a year-over-year increase of approximately 29.9%, marking its first Non-GAAP profit of $12.3 million [7]. - Q2 revenue continued to grow by 28.55% to $73.3 million, with a net profit of $3.128 million [8]. - Q3 revenue reached $81.6 million, up about 34%, with a Non-GAAP net profit of $20.1 million [8]. - Q4 revenue further increased to $82.1 million, with a total annual revenue of $299 million [8]. Business Segments - The IoT PaaS segment remains the core business, generating $217 million in revenue for 2024, a 29.4% increase from the previous year [10][11]. - The smart solutions segment saw the fastest growth, with a revenue increase of 58.3% to $42 million, driven by demand in various sectors including smart energy and smart retail [12]. - The software SaaS services and other businesses showed stable growth, with a year-over-year increase of approximately 10.6% to $39.6 million [12]. Market Position and Strategy - Tuya Smart's DBNER (Dollar-Based Net Expansion Rate) improved from 103% to 122%, indicating enhanced business expansion capabilities within existing customers [11]. - The company focuses on strategic customer engagement, leading to increased operational efficiency and profitability [11]. - Tuya Smart is actively investing in AI, cloud computing, and edge computing to enhance its technological capabilities and product competitiveness [13][14]. Future Outlook - The global IoT market is expected to continue its rapid growth, providing significant opportunities for Tuya Smart [13]. - The company plans to expand its presence in both domestic and international markets, leveraging its technological advantages [14]. - Tuya Smart's board has approved a dividend of $0.0608 per share, totaling approximately $37 million, reflecting its strong cash position of $1.017 billion as of December 31, 2024 [14][15].
